What year did Ford make a 406 engine?
1962
For 1962, Ford launched its 406-cubic-inch V-8 as a racing homologation special; it used the 390’s 3.785-inch stroke, but bored things out . 080, to 4.13 inches. Two versions were available: the four-barrel version offering 385 horsepower, and the tri-power variant was rated at 405 horsepower.
Did Ford make a 406 engine?
The 406 was Ford’s response. It wasn’t a big change from the 390, just a 0.080-inch-larger bore, with thicker walls in the engine block casting. Compression went from 10.6:1 to 10.9, exhaust valves got slightly larger, and to take the extra stress, piston and connecting rods were strengthened.

How much horsepower does a Ford 406 have?
380 horsepower
Our scratchy ol’ 406 makes 380 horsepower and at least 450 lb-ft of torque-for less than $2,000. A 406-inch Windsor, based on the 351ci Ford, is light for its displacement but costs a lot of money to build and involves a stroker crankshaft assembly. For our thumper, we used a 400M block.

What is the bore of a 406 Ford?
4.130 3.784
You’ve got the venerable Windsor small block, plus the 385-series and FE-series big block branches, along with a trio of 351 engines—the 351 Windsor, Cleveland, and Modified….Ford V8 Engine Bore and Stroke Chart.
| Ford Stock Engine Bore and Stroke Guide | ||
|---|---|---|
| 406 | 4.130 | 3.784 |
| 410 | 4.050 | 3.980 |
| 427 | 4.230 | 3.780 |
| 428 | 4.130 | 3.980 |
